In den WarenkorbPaperback. Zustand: New. Print on Demand. This book's focus is on identifying grasses by examining their leaves, a method that is more accessible and accurate than using the flowers. The author has devised a simple system to classify different types of grasses, using the color of the leaf sheaths at their base and other distinctive characteristics. This enables quick identification of common pasture grasses at any time of year when flowers are not present. By using this approach, farmers and agriculturalists can accurately analyze the quality of their pastures to determine what is growing there, informing decisions on livestock grazing. In den Warenkorbpp.vi, 92 with colour and b/w. illus., plus 4 pages of adverts. Small 8vo. Signature of Dr. John Ramsbottom to ffep., with his occasional neat informed annotations in pencil and ink. A vg. plus hardback in original green cloth boards with gilt lettering. A unique copy. Dr. John Ramsbottom OBE FLS (1885-1974) was a highly respected British mycologist. He was Keeper of Botany at the British Museum and President of both the British Mycological Society and the Linnean Society. He wrote quite extensively and was author of 'Mushrooms & Toadstools', the seventh volume in Collins' New Naturalist series.
